Job Description

Moderne Barn Restaurant is seeking a passionate, knowledgeable Lead Sommelier & Beverage Specialist to curate our award-winning wine and beverage program. This is a non-managerial, service-focused position that participates in the restaurant's tip pool. You will handle beverage procurement, inventory logistics, and table-side guest service, while also executing nightly operational lock-up procedures 5 days a week with possible adjustments. Duties and Responsibiliti es . Collaborates with Ownership to develop, maintain, and evolve the wine program in alignment with menu offerings Provides expert wine service and guidance to guests, ensuring hospitality, education, and personalized recommendations Assists guests with wine selections, pairings, and menu guidance; answers questions regarding preparation or ingredients Oversees operational aspects of the wine program, purchasing of alcoholic spirits including inventory, stock control, and budget adherence Supports training and development of team members on wine knowledge, service protocols, and operational standards Maintains thorough knowledge of menu items, wine list, specials, and recommended pairings. Participates in pre-shift meetings, tastings, and team training sessions as the voice of the wine program Handles guest inquiries, requests, and concerns professionally, escalating to management when necessary Supports all aspects of service as needed to ensure exceptional guest experiences Maintains bar, wine cellar, and workspaces; reports maintenance or safety concerns promptly Ensures compliance with all Department of Health, sanitation, safety, and responsible alcohol service regulations Attends required staff and leadership meetings Adheres to posted schedules, attendance, and punctuality standards Performs additional duties as assigned by management Qualifications Minimum of 1 year of experience as a sommelier in an upscale or high-volume hospitality environment Strong knowledge of wine, spirits, wine service, and culinary terminology Fluency in spoken and written English High school diploma or GED required Proficiency with restaurant POS systems and basic computer applications Ability to work flexible schedules, including nights, weekends, and holidays Excellent interpersonal, written, and verbal communication skills Strong organizational, time management, and problem-solving abilities Ability to remain calm and effective in a fast-paced environment Polished personal appearance Passion for hospitality, wine, and guest service excellence Essential Functions and Physical Demands This position requires the ability to perform essential functions with or without reasonable accommodation Standing and remaining active for up to 10 hours per shift Lifting and carrying items weighing up to 50 pounds Frequently walking, reaching, bending, stooping, pushing, pulling, and kneeling Frequently using stairs, often while carrying items Occasionally crouching and climbing Safely working around hot surfaces, sharp objects, wet floors, and temperature fluctuations (from hot kitchens to freezers) Exposure to common allergens and specialty ingredients
